Output 866f230dc15729b36835541e69af5f136593f32bb3162bedcab3377237c27994:0

value
1015100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f12a5339c0b11dd51e2c6529e9ecfd3a32b50f14 OP_EQUAL
address
3PgBUaGVarB337XLha6n7djPLytXKquviB
transaction
866f230dc15729b36835541e69af5f136593f32bb3162bedcab3377237c27994
spent
true